class $22ef0686d6af4fda$export$a05409b8bb224a5a {
    constructor(...args){
        if (args.length === 1) {
            let opts = args[0];
            this.collection = opts.collection;
            this.ref = opts.ref;
            this.collator = opts.collator;
            this.disabledKeys = opts.disabledKeys || new Set();
            this.disabledBehavior = opts.disabledBehavior || 'all';
            this.orientation = opts.orientation || 'vertical';
            this.direction = opts.direction;
            this.layout = opts.layout || 'stack';
            this.layoutDelegate = opts.layoutDelegate || new (0, $0e21c65e8f2fcfc9$exports.DOMLayoutDelegate)(opts.ref);
        } else {
            this.collection = args[0];
            this.disabledKeys = args[1];
            this.ref = args[2];
            this.collator = args[3];
            this.layout = 'stack';
            this.orientation = 'vertical';
            this.disabledBehavior = 'all';
            this.layoutDelegate = new (0, $0e21c65e8f2fcfc9$exports.DOMLayoutDelegate)(this.ref);
        }
        // If this is a vertical stack, remove the left/right methods completely
        // so they aren't called by useDroppableCollection.
        if (this.layout === 'stack' && this.orientation === 'vertical') {
            this.getKeyLeftOf = undefined;
            this.getKeyRightOf = undefined;
        }
    }
    isDisabled(item) {
        return this.disabledBehavior === 'all' && (item.props?.isDisabled || this.disabledKeys.has(item.key)) && item.props?.disabledBehavior !== 'selection';
    }
    findNextNonDisabled(key, getNext, includeDisabled = false) {
        let nextKey = key;
        while(nextKey != null){
            let item = this.collection.getItem(nextKey);
            if (item?.type === 'item' && (includeDisabled || !this.isDisabled(item))) return nextKey;
            nextKey = getNext(nextKey);
        }
        return null;
    }
    getNextKey(key, options) {
        let nextKey = key;
        nextKey = this.collection.getKeyAfter(nextKey);
        return this.findNextNonDisabled(nextKey, (key)=>this.collection.getKeyAfter(key), options?.includeDisabled);
    }
    getPreviousKey(key, options) {
        let nextKey = key;
        nextKey = this.collection.getKeyBefore(nextKey);
        return this.findNextNonDisabled(nextKey, (key)=>this.collection.getKeyBefore(key), options?.includeDisabled);
    }
    findKey(key, nextKey, shouldSkip) {
        let tempKey = key;
        let itemRect = this.layoutDelegate.getItemRect(tempKey);
        if (!itemRect || tempKey == null) return null;
        // Find the item above or below in the same column.
        let prevRect = itemRect;
        do {
            tempKey = nextKey(tempKey);
            if (tempKey == null) break;
            itemRect = this.layoutDelegate.getItemRect(tempKey);
        }while (itemRect && shouldSkip(prevRect, itemRect) && tempKey != null);
        return tempKey;
    }
    isSameRow(prevRect, itemRect) {
        return prevRect.y === itemRect.y || prevRect.x !== itemRect.x;
    }
    isSameColumn(prevRect, itemRect) {
        return prevRect.x === itemRect.x || prevRect.y !== itemRect.y;
    }
    getKeyBelow(key, options) {
        if (this.layout === 'grid' && this.orientation === 'vertical') return this.findKey(key, (key)=>this.getNextKey(key, options), this.isSameRow);
        else return this.getNextKey(key, options);
    }
    getKeyAbove(key, options) {
        if (this.layout === 'grid' && this.orientation === 'vertical') return this.findKey(key, (key)=>this.getPreviousKey(key, options), this.isSameRow);
        else return this.getPreviousKey(key, options);
    }
    getNextColumn(key, right, options) {
        return right ? this.getPreviousKey(key, options) : this.getNextKey(key, options);
    }
    getKeyRightOf(key, options) {
        // This is a temporary solution for CardView until we refactor useSelectableCollection.
        // https://github.com/orgs/adobe/projects/19/views/32?pane=issue&itemId=77825042
        let layoutDelegateMethod = this.direction === 'ltr' ? 'getKeyRightOf' : 'getKeyLeftOf';
        if (this.layoutDelegate[layoutDelegateMethod]) {
            key = this.layoutDelegate[layoutDelegateMethod](key);
            return this.findNextNonDisabled(key, (key)=>this.layoutDelegate[layoutDelegateMethod](key), options?.includeDisabled);
        }
        if (this.layout === 'grid') {
            if (this.orientation === 'vertical') return this.getNextColumn(key, this.direction === 'rtl', options);
            else return this.findKey(key, (key)=>this.getNextColumn(key, this.direction === 'rtl', options), this.isSameColumn);
        } else if (this.orientation === 'horizontal') return this.getNextColumn(key, this.direction === 'rtl', options);
        return null;
    }
    getKeyLeftOf(key, options) {
        let layoutDelegateMethod = this.direction === 'ltr' ? 'getKeyLeftOf' : 'getKeyRightOf';
        if (this.layoutDelegate[layoutDelegateMethod]) {
            key = this.layoutDelegate[layoutDelegateMethod](key);
            return this.findNextNonDisabled(key, (key)=>this.layoutDelegate[layoutDelegateMethod](key), options?.includeDisabled);
        }
        if (this.layout === 'grid') {
            if (this.orientation === 'vertical') return this.getNextColumn(key, this.direction === 'ltr', options);
            else return this.findKey(key, (key)=>this.getNextColumn(key, this.direction === 'ltr', options), this.isSameColumn);
        } else if (this.orientation === 'horizontal') return this.getNextColumn(key, this.direction === 'ltr', options);
        return null;
    }
    getFirstKey() {
        let key = this.collection.getFirstKey();
        return this.findNextNonDisabled(key, (key)=>this.collection.getKeyAfter(key));
    }
    getLastKey() {
        let key = this.collection.getLastKey();
        return this.findNextNonDisabled(key, (key)=>this.collection.getKeyBefore(key));
    }
    getKeyPageAbove(key) {
        let menu = this.ref.current;
        let itemRect = this.layoutDelegate.getItemRect(key);
        if (!itemRect) return null;
        if (menu && !(0, $c3942aba3ca10757$exports.isScrollable)(menu)) return this.getFirstKey();
        let nextKey = key;
        if (this.orientation === 'horizontal') {
            let pageX = Math.max(0, itemRect.x + itemRect.width - this.layoutDelegate.getVisibleRect().width);
            while(itemRect && itemRect.x > pageX && nextKey != null){
                nextKey = this.getKeyAbove(nextKey);
                itemRect = nextKey == null ? null : this.layoutDelegate.getItemRect(nextKey);
            }
        } else {
            let pageY = Math.max(0, itemRect.y + itemRect.height - this.layoutDelegate.getVisibleRect().height);
            while(itemRect && itemRect.y > pageY && nextKey != null){
                nextKey = this.getKeyAbove(nextKey);
                itemRect = nextKey == null ? null : this.layoutDelegate.getItemRect(nextKey);
            }
        }
        return nextKey ?? this.getFirstKey();
    }
    getKeyPageBelow(key) {
        let menu = this.ref.current;
        let itemRect = this.layoutDelegate.getItemRect(key);
        if (!itemRect) return null;
        if (menu && !(0, $c3942aba3ca10757$exports.isScrollable)(menu)) return this.getLastKey();
        let nextKey = key;
        if (this.orientation === 'horizontal') {
            let pageX = Math.min(this.layoutDelegate.getContentSize().width, itemRect.x - itemRect.width + this.layoutDelegate.getVisibleRect().width);
            while(itemRect && itemRect.x < pageX && nextKey != null){
                nextKey = this.getKeyBelow(nextKey);
                itemRect = nextKey == null ? null : this.layoutDelegate.getItemRect(nextKey);
            }
        } else {
            let pageY = Math.min(this.layoutDelegate.getContentSize().height, itemRect.y - itemRect.height + this.layoutDelegate.getVisibleRect().height);
            while(itemRect && itemRect.y < pageY && nextKey != null){
                nextKey = this.getKeyBelow(nextKey);
                itemRect = nextKey == null ? null : this.layoutDelegate.getItemRect(nextKey);
            }
        }
        return nextKey ?? this.getLastKey();
    }
    getKeyForSearch(search, fromKey) {
        if (!this.collator) return null;
        let collection = this.collection;
        let key = fromKey || this.getFirstKey();
        while(key != null){
            let item = collection.getItem(key);
            if (!item) return null;
            let substring = item.textValue.slice(0, search.length);
            if (item.textValue && this.collator.compare(substring, search) === 0) return key;
            key = this.getNextKey(key);
        }
        return null;
    }
}
